摘要 | Integrating the mobility support functionality into the network architecture intrinsically is becoming a key factor for Future Internet Architecture (FIA). This paper proposes a novel network mobility (NEMO) support method in eXpressive Internet Architecture (XIA), a new FIA currently under development as part of the US National Science Foundation's (NSF) program. We introduce a Rendezvous Agent (RA) providing mobility service for each mobile node and Mobile Router (MR) in XIA. We also set the fallback to RA in mobile node's DAG to ensure the reachability for every node. Moreover, a RA Binding List (RBL) is created and maintained by MR to accelerate binding update procedure for the mobile nodes inside MR. Our proposed method is effective in complicated mobility scenarios, while simple in network control plane and efficient in data plane. |
